Finding Reference Range Txt
| Description | Reference ranges are a set of values used to interpret clinical findings. The values would include the upper and lower limits for a specific clinical finding. For Example: Potassium has a reference range of 3.5 - 5.2 mmols/L which means a potassium level above 5.2 mmols/l would be considered high. |

Organism Susceptibility Code Sk
| Description | Identifies a set of one or more observations about the resistance or vulnerability of an isolate (organism) to a drug, often an antibiotic. It is used by healthcare practitioners to prescribe the most appropriate medication for the patient's diagnosis. Susceptibilities are identified through microbiology testing. For Example: The bacteria Clostridium Difficile is sensitive to the antibiotic clindamycin |
